Portland, United States
New
0
25

Portland

United States

Portland dazzles with its blend of lush, green neighborhoods and a thriving food scene, where farm‑to‑table eateries sit alongside iconic food carts serving global flavors. The city’s riverfront parks, bike‑friendly streets, and nearby Columbia River Gorge waterfalls create endless outdoor adventures, while quirky districts like the Pearl District and Alberta Arts showcase vibrant street art, craft breweries, and indie music venues.

Seattle, United States
New
0
28

Seattle

United States

Seattle dazzles with its waterfront skyline framed by the iconic Space Needle and the snow‑capped peaks of the Cascade Range, offering breathtaking views from Pike Place Market to the bustling waterfront. The city’s vibrant coffee culture, thriving music scene, and eclectic neighborhoods like Capitol Hill create an energetic, laid‑back vibe that feels both cosmopolitan and uniquely Pacific‑Northwest. Outdoor lovers can hop on a ferry to explore nearby islands, kayak on Lake Union, or hike the lush trails of Discovery Park, making Seattle a perfect blend of urban excitement and natural beauty.

Utah, United States
New
0
22

Utah

United States

Utah, a state of breathtaking natural beauty, boasts a diverse landscape of red rock canyons, towering mountain ranges, and vast deserts. The American Southwest's iconic landmarks, such as Arches and Canyonlands National Parks, draw visitors from around the world with their unique rock formations and stunning vistas. From the serene Lake Powell to the rugged terrain of Zion National Park, Utah's dramatic scenery makes it a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ers.

Boston, United States
New
0
21

Boston

United States

Boston, a historic coastal city, is nestled along the Charles River in Suffolk County, Massachusetts. Its charming blend of colonial architecture and modern amenities creates a unique urban landscape, with iconic landmarks like Faneuil Hall and the Old State House drawing visitors from around the world. The city's vibrant neighborhoods, such as the North End and Beacon Hill, offer a glimpse into Boston's rich history and cultural heritage.

Fresno, United States
New
0
7

Fresno

United States

Fresno is a vibrant city nestled in California's Central Valley, surrounded by rolling hills and lush farmland that contrasts with its urban landscape. Visitors can explore the city's rich cultural heritage at the Forestiere Underground Gardens, a unique network of underground tunnels and rooms carved into the earth by a single artist. The Tower District, with its colorful murals and lively atmosphere, is another must-visit destination.
